css如何将两个小盒子水平居中 而且间距30

作者&投稿:善信 (若有异议请与网页底部的电邮联系)
css如何将盒子水平居中放置~

一个盒子的话就设置margin属性就可以了。
margin: 0 auto;
前提是盒子有宽度。当然没宽度也看不出居中没有。

方法一、小div绝对定位或相对定位,这样小div脱离标准流,大div有固定宽高,用小div的margin去挤大div

Title
.father{
width: 600px;
height: 600px;
background-color: orangered;
}
.son{
width: 300px;
height: 200px;
background-color: lawngreen;
position: absolute;
margin: 200px 150px;
}

注意:如果小div没有绝对定位或相对定位,且大div没有border,那么小div的margin实际上踹的是“流”,踹的是这“行”。如果用margin-top,大div整体也掉下来了。如下:

方法二、如果给大div加一个border,使大div,小div都不定位,用小div的margin去挤大div,实现小div居中。

Title
.father{
width: 600px;
height: 600px;
background-color: orangered;
border: 1px solid white;
}
.son{
width: 300px;
height: 200px;
background-color: lawngreen;
margin: 200px 150px;
}

显示结果如下:

方法三、小div绝对定位,大div相对定位,定位到大盒子的宽高一半的位置,再上下各margin负的自己宽高的一半

Title
.father{
width: 600px;
height: 600px;
background-color: orangered;
position: relative;
}
.son{
width: 300px;
height: 200px;
background-color: lawngreen;
position: absolute;
top: 50%;
left: 50%;
margin-top: -100px;
margin-left: -150px;
}


显示结果如下:

扩展资料:

一个绝对定位的元素,如果父辈元素中出现了也定位了的元素,那么将以父辈这个元素,为参考点。工程上,“子绝父相”有意义,父亲元素没有脱标,儿子元素脱标在父亲元素的范围里面移动。
绝对定位之后,所有标准流的规则,都不适用了。所以margin:0 auto;失效。
display:inline和display:inline-block,会使margin:0 auto;失效。
固定宽度的盒子才能使用margin:0 auto;居中

将两个小盒子水平居中 通常是使用 margin auto来实现,间距30 可以外边距都为 15 ,也可以在一个盒子设置外边距为30 px。

这里可以用两种方法来解决,第一个就是给他们一个父元素,两个盒子加上边边距就是430 为父元素的宽 ,加上margin 0  auto的属性就实现了

第二就是用弹性盒来做 同样加父元素 只不过注意将盒子为弹性盒 ,display的值为 flex ,父元素加上属性 justify-content:center 就可以实现了。

平时需要多看一下这方面的教程 和 多敲多练习这方面的。



<div style="width:430px; margin:0 auto; overflow:hidden">
    <div style="width:200px; height:100px; margin-right:30px; background-color:red; float:left;"></div>
    <div style="width:200px; height:100px; background-color:skyblue; float:left;"></div>
 </div>

效果图:




两只小仓鼠可以放一起吗
仓鼠怀孕的同时还可以继续受精,无限制的生下去,生一大窝你就麻烦了。二是两个公的,99%的机会会打架,把对方咬死。三是两个都是母的,如果是同一个妈妈生的两个姐妹,可能不会打架,不是同一个妈妈,就会打架。所以为了SS和你们好,还是分笼吧。 一字一句打出来的,希望采纳 ...

我家新养了只SS,要怎么好好照顾啊?新手一个袅~
【仓鼠的基本用品】笼子 食盆 大多数笼子中都自带食盆。如果需要自己选购,一般的小容器都可选用,只要是不容易打翻,且边缘不要太高,不然仓鼠爬不进去。常用的容器:玻璃烟缸,酱油碟子,各类小碗,微波炉盒子。目前价格:3-10元 饮水器 大多数笼子中都自带饮水器,DIY时也最好装一个,因为仓鼠是需要...

请教QQ幻想SS玩法!!
43级学习的风焰术和暴雪术用起来应该得心应手,不单是攻击范围和攻击力得到大步提升,技能特效也颇具震憾力,所以SS注定是五大职业中的佼佼者,如果现在你去试练的话,肯定好多人抢的哦。大范围的技能间隔时间较长,必须配合小范围使用,大小范围连环出击,打得怪怪们落花流水,是不是很过瘾啊!所以这两个技能一定要加...

双SS减肥药有效么
我认为不要乱减肥,副作用多还不一定减的了,我以前就试过很多方法都不管用。跳绳胸会下垂,效果也不怎么理想。呼啦圈更可怕没瘦多少,胸还减了一圈,本来胸就不大,更小了,而且反弹更是快。跑步跑了一个月,就减了1斤,小腿还长肌肉了。为了减肥我用了至少几十种方法,就是减不下来。后来我...

我是WOW的一个SS 狗任务怎么接不到。
躲在海底,用遥控眼去找一下npc,找到后才上岸.第二部份要你去找两件物品,一件在南海镇旁的海滩,另一件在千针岛人马营的 山洞内.拿到物品回去后便是把地狱犬召出来再打死它便可以拿到.南海镇的物品:从南海镇往南走到达海滩后再往西走.建议你在海中游过去,因为那个物品是很小的一个篮色盒子,在...

怎样养好仓鼠?
这点经验希望能够帮到你,祝你和你的SS相处愉快~!2.他的房子要有这些:水分:鼠鼠可以不用喝水,如果要喝切记一定要烧开的水!要绝对干净。Shishi家的鼠鼠,妈妈都是给它们吃蔬菜水果来摄取水分的!因为它们实在很小,所以一点点的水分就足够了!它们最爱吃青菜,记得青菜一定要漂洗干净,风里吹干。黄芽菜卷心菜也都...

200分求 wow 插件问题 ss老手 高手来
Chatter:聊天增强sexmap:性感小地图 ClosetGnome:一键换装 CloseUp:试衣间增强 DCT:伤害显示器 DMB:首领警报模块 Decursive:一键驱散 EasyTrinket:饰品管理器 Engravings:物品信息 FuBar:信息条 Grid:团队框体 Icetip:鼠标提示增强 NECB:敌方冷却监视 Omen:仇恨统计 oRA2:团队...

...盒子很小——为了不被发现,我没买笼子——那怎么解决它的喝水问题...
1 喂点水果蔬菜之类的 不过别常喂 吃多了含大量水分的食物容易拉稀 2你用个瓶盖或者小点的容器当水壶 不过要当心别洒出来的 盒子很小的话 那种专门的水壶不怎么好弄 还有现在夏天了 仓鼠的生活环境不打理会比较臭

新手养仓鼠,想要可爱温顺的,不要过分活泼的,爱亲近人不怎么咬人的...
(1)食盆:什么都可以,包括干净的烟灰缸、小盒子等….注意边缘,不要刮伤鼠儿。 (2)滚轮:请选用无缝滚轮,有缝的轮子,鼠儿跑步时容易卡到脚。 (3)水瓶:钢珠式的水瓶最佳,也有滴管式,最主要以不会漏水为最先考量。 (4)小窝:可以自己做,用面纸盒、纸盒等,也可选用市面上贩售的小窝,还可以用玻璃调料瓶哦,...

饲养仓鼠
3:要给鼠鼠洗澡就买一个澡盆给它(这个宠物店里也一定有的),用法很简单,把浴沙倒进澡盆里,别太满,放在鼠鼠的小屋里,鼠鼠很聪明的,自己就会洗澡了,你只要平均两天换一次浴沙就好了,当你看见浴沙有点发黄或者有黑色的小粒粒出现的时候,就要换了哦~!!4:磨牙棒我建议别买太大的因为鼠...

长春市18571155455: 题:如何用css让一个容器水平垂直居中 -
并萧普罗: 垂直居中有一下四种方式:方法1:.parent { width:800px; height:500px; border:2px solid #000; position:relative;} .child { width:200px; height:200px; margin: auto; position: absolute; top: 0; left: 0; bottom: 0; right: 0; background-color: red;}方法2:....

长春市18571155455: css布局,两个div左右浮动后,里面的盒子如何居中 -
并萧普罗: 给里面盒子一个宽度然后通过margin:auto让他居中举例<div style="float:left;width:50%; ">第一个盒子(左) <div style="width:50px;height:30px; margin:auto;">里面的盒子</div></div><div style="float:right;width:50%;">第二个盒子(右)</div>

长春市18571155455: 盒子中第二个怎么居中? -
并萧普罗: 如果是相对整个屏幕居中显示,可以直接添加css:margin:0 auto; 如果是要先对上面的黑色区域居中显示,那就需要在外面增加一个div框,再给黄色区域添加margin:0 auto; 代码:<div 宽度和黑色区域相同> <div>黑色</div> <div>黄色</div></div>

长春市18571155455: 如何用css实现元素水平与垂直居中 -
并萧普罗: 用CSS弹性盒子模型,可以做到让子元素水平和垂直居中!看下面加粗的代码:div.container { background-color:yellow; height: 200px; width: 500px; display: flex; flex-direction:column; justify-content:center; align-items: center; } 效果图:一个DIV下面有3个子DIV元素

长春市18571155455: CSS中怎么让DIV居中 -
并萧普罗: 主要css代码有两个:1,text-align:center 2,margin:0 auto;其两个样式需要配合使用才能实现div盒子的居中显示排版.首先我们对body设置text-align:center,再对需要居中的div盒子设置css样式margin:0 auto,这样即可让对应div水平居中.举个...

长春市18571155455: div css如何实现子DIV里的多个子DIV水平居中? -
并萧普罗: #find_button{ height: 25px; width: 950px; margin: 0 auto;/*需设置宽度才能居中,*/ text-align:center;/*如果无法兼容IE6,可以加上这句*/ }

长春市18571155455: css中div中有两个块元素,float:left,如何才能居中显示? -
并萧普罗: CSS中首选的让元素水平居中的方法就是使用margin属性—将元素的margin-left和margin-right属性设置为auto即可.

长春市18571155455: 如何用CSS让一个容器水平垂直居中 -
并萧普罗: position: fixed; left;30%: 300px;0 auto; background: red; margin;0;0: right;top; &nbsp:&nbsp: &nbspdiv }自己运行到浏览器上看看; &nbsp: { width: 500px; height

长春市18571155455: 在css怎样是div盒子居中的问题
并萧普罗: CSS设置 div居中的属性 是 margin:0 auto; 例如: -------------------------------- -------------------------------- 这样中间那个DIV就是居中显示的.

长春市18571155455: css 盒子嵌套多个盒子如何两端对齐 -
并萧普罗: 整体是300px吧?<style> ul, li { margin: 0; padding: 0; list-style: none; } ul { position: relative; width: 300px; height: 100px; background: #aaa; } li { position: absolute; top: 5px; width: 95px; height: 90px; background: #ddd; }.left_li { left: 0; }.middle_li { left:...

本站内容来自于网友发表,不代表本站立场,仅表示其个人看法,不对其真实性、正确性、有效性作任何的担保
相关事宜请发邮件给我们
© 星空见康网